Shandong vs Cangzhou Mighty Lions: Team News and Match Preview
Shandong Taishan
From finishing the fifth last campaign to taking pole position after 13 match days, Shandong Taishan has taken great leaps in the Super League. The job is not complete and Hao Wei will be well versed with the challenge at hand as Guangzhou FC breathe down their necks. Despite the obstacles at hand, Taishan Dui will fancy their chances given the increase in their scoring prowess. Moreover, their defensive performances would have added confidence in their ability as they have only conceded nine goals this season, the best tally in the league.
Cangzhou Mighty Lions
The Mighty Lions ended their four-match winless streak against Shenzhen and will look to improve their standing in the Super League. However, Afshin Ghotbi has his work cut out for himself as he leads the Cangzhou Mighty Lions against league leaders Shandong Taishan. Their defence which has conceded 21 goals this season will come under pressure and it remains to be seen how they fare against Taishan Dui's attack. The bigger question marks remain about their attackers who average less than a goal and face the best defence in the league.
